The Scroll Lock Key: From Spreadsheet Savior to Digital Relic
Once upon a time, in the era of giant spreadsheets and monochrome monitors, Scroll Lock was king. Its job was to lock the scrolling of the screen content, independent of the cursor’s position. Think of it as anchoring your spreadsheet view while you navigated the cells. Now? Well, let’s just say its resume is a little outdated.
- History: In ancient times (the 80s and 90s), this key helped users navigate large datasets in programs like Lotus 1-2-3.
- Modern Use: Good luck finding a program that actively uses Scroll Lock today! Excel is one of the very few applications that still respond to it, and even there, its functionality is pretty niche.
- Troubleshooting: Accidentally hit Scroll Lock? Don’t panic! Your arrow keys are probably just scrolling the window instead of moving the active cell. Just tap it again, and you’re back in business.
The Pause/Break Key: A Vestige of Command-Line Days
Ah, the Pause/Break key – a relic from the days when computers spoke in command prompts and everything was a text-based adventure. In those days, it was your go-to for halting runaway processes or taking a breather during a long, scrolling output.
- Original Design: This key was designed to pause or interrupt programs running in DOS or other command-line environments.
- Modern Functionality: In the world of graphical user interfaces (GUIs), Pause/Break is mostly a historical artifact. Some older programs or system tools might still recognize it, but its usefulness is…questionable.
- Historical Anecdote: Back in the day, hitting Pause/Break during a boot sequence was a common way to read the BIOS information. Try it sometime; you might feel like a digital archaeologist.
The Print Screen Key: Capturing Moments in Pixels
Print Screen is the granddaddy of screenshots. While it’s been around forever, its functionality has definitely evolved with the times.
- Primary Function: Its original (and still primary) job is to capture an image of your entire screen.
- How it Evolved: Modern operating systems offer far more sophisticated screenshot tools, like Windows’ Snipping Tool or macOS’s built-in screenshot shortcuts (Shift-Command-4, anyone?). These tools let you capture specific regions, annotate images, and more.
- Modern Uses: The old Print Screen key still works! Pressing it copies a snapshot of your screen to your clipboard.
- Alt + Print Screen captures only the active window.
- Windows Key + Print Screen saves a full-screen screenshot directly to your Pictures folder.
- Tips and Tricks: Remember to paste (Ctrl+V or Command+V) your screenshot into an image editor (like Paint, Photoshop, or even Word) to save it as a file!
The SysRq Key: A Linux Power-User’s Secret Weapon
SysRq, or System Request, is like the secret handshake of Linux system administrators. It’s a powerful key combination that allows you to send low-level commands directly to the kernel, even when the system is in a dire state.
- Role: Primarily in Linux systems, it’s used for low-level commands.
- Modern Uses: It is used for safe reboots, debugging, and system recovery (Magic SysRq key combinations).
- Safety Note: Be cautious! Using SysRq commands improperly can lead to data loss or system instability. It’s best left to experienced Linux users.
The Insert Key: The Accidental Overwrite Enabler
The Insert key. Oh, the Insert key. It has the power to turn your carefully crafted text into a jumbled mess.
- History: Back in the day, it toggled between insert mode (where new text pushes existing text forward) and overwrite mode (where new text replaces existing text).
- Modern Use: These days, Insert is mostly a source of accidental frustration. How many times have you unknowingly switched to overwrite mode and started obliterating your precious words?
- Troubleshooting: Many word processors and text editors have a setting to disable insert mode altogether. You can also remap the key using software like AutoHotkey.
The Num Lock Key: Taming the Numeric Keypad
The Num Lock key is actually one of the more useful “odd” keys, especially if you’re a fan of number crunching.
- Function: It toggles the numeric keypad on and off.
- Modern Relevance: On desktop keyboards with a dedicated numeric keypad, Num Lock is essential for using the keypad for numbers instead of navigation (arrow keys, Home, End, etc.).
- Laptop Considerations: On laptops without a dedicated keypad, Num Lock often activates a virtual keypad overlaid on other keys.
- Accessibility: For users who rely on the numeric keypad for input, ensuring Num Lock is properly configured is critical.

Backward Compatibility: The Golden Rule (and its Exceptions)
Here’s a golden rule in tech: don’t break things that already work! (Unless, of course, you’re a software update. Just kidding…mostly). Backward compatibility means that new hardware and software should still be able to work with older stuff. Imagine the chaos if suddenly your new laptop couldn’t run software from the early 2000s! Removing “odd keys” might seem like a simple cleanup, but it could potentially break compatibility with specialized software or older hardware that still relies on them. The Price of a Makeover: More Than Just Spare Change
Redesigning a keyboard might seem like a simple task, but it involves significant investment. Companies need to retool manufacturing processes, update drivers, and potentially even rewrite software to accommodate the changes. All this costs money and effort. The big question is, would removing a few rarely used keys provide enough benefit to justify the expense? For most manufacturers, the answer is a resounding no. OS Level Key Remapping: The Built-In Magic
Both Windows and macOS offer ways to tweak your keyboard without needing extra software.
Windows: Unleash PowerToys
Windows users, say hello to PowerToys! This free utility from Microsoft is a treasure trove of handy tools, including a robust Keyboard Manager. It’s surprisingly simple: you pick a key (say, that dusty Scroll Lock), and then choose the function you want it to perform (maybe muting your mic for those sudden Zoom calls).
macOS: Keyboard Shortcuts Galore
Mac users, you’re in luck too! While macOS doesn’t have a dedicated remapping tool, the Keyboard Shortcuts settings are surprisingly powerful. You can assign specific key combinations to launch applications, execute Automator workflows, or even run shell scripts, turning those “odd keys” into personalized command centers!
Third-Party Key Mapping Software: Beyond the Basics
Want even more control? Third-party software is your playground!
AutoHotkey (Windows): The Scripting Superhero
For Windows users who like to tinker, AutoHotkey is legendary. It’s a scripting language that lets you create custom keyboard shortcuts, automate repetitive tasks, and remap keys with incredible precision. It might have a bit of a learning curve, but the possibilities are endless.

Beyond the Keyboard: Alternative Input Methods to Consider
It’s also important to remember that the physical keyboard isn’t the only option. Assistive technology offers a wide array of alternative input methods that can be incredibly empowering:
- On-Screen Keyboards: These virtual keyboards can be controlled with a mouse, trackball, or even eye-tracking technology.
- Voice Recognition Software: Dictation software allows users to control their computers with their voice, bypassing the need for a keyboard altogether.
- Adaptive Switches: These specialized devices allow users to perform actions with minimal movement, such as pressing a button with their head or foot.
- Head Pointers: These devices translate head movements into cursor control, enabling hands-free interaction with the computer.
